#0bccc4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0bccc4 is composed of 4.3% red, 80%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.9%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 177.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 42.2%. #0bccc4 color hex could be obtained by blending #16ffff with #009989.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#0bccc4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0bccc4 has RGB values of R:11, G:204,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 773316.

Shades and Tints of #0bccc4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011211 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0bccc4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#667171 is the less saturated color, while #03d4cc is the most saturated one.
